General Description
We are looking for highly motivated individuals who are interested in gaining on-the-job experience in metal fabrication to join our team. Generally, this position involves cleaning and preparing miscellaneous metals and structural parts for welding and paint. The Grinder will learn and operate a variety of power and hand tools.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
This list of duties and responsibilities is not all-inclusive and may be expanded to include other duties and responsibilities as management may deem necessary from time to time.
1. Following directions under limited supervision.
2. Provide weld clean-up and ensure parts are paint ready.
3. Assist and support all BCT team members and departments when needed.
4. Identify and use proper consumables for appropriate prepping methods depending on the alloy.
5. Proper PPE and safe working methods is a must. PPE is provided
6. Identify and prepare parts for fabrication according to cut lists, drawings, and leader direction.
7. Operate angle grinders, die grinders, pencil grinders, belt sanders, and other power tools to debur and grind parts.
8. Examine work pieces for defects and report issues as necessary to the Fabricator or Supervisor.
9. Lifting and loading parts onto shelves and welding tables.
10. Occasional mobile prepping when needed.
11. Operate overhead cranes, jib cranes, and forklifts.
12. Conduct activities in a safe and healthy manner and work in accordance with established safety and company requirements.
13. Exceptional attendance.
14. Keeping equipment and work area clean and orderly and perform basic preventative maintenance functions on equipment.
15. Helps drive and support BCT's Culture and Core Values

Physical Demands
The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ions. The phrases "occasionally," "regularly," and "frequently" correspond to the following definitions: "Occasionally" means up to 1/3 of working time, "regularly" means between 1/3 and 2/3 of working time, and "frequently" means 2/3 and more working time.
While performing the duties and responsibilities of this position, the employee is occasionally required to sit and use foot/feet to operate machinery. The incumbent will regularly talk and listen, climb or balance and reach above shoulders. He/she will frequently stand, walk, use hands to finger, handle or touch, stoop, kneel, crouch or crawl and move from place to place. Specific vision requirements for this position include close vision, color vision, and depth perception. The employee will occasionally lift up to 50 pounds and maneuver several hundred pounds a short distance. The employee will frequently lift up to 25 pounds. Employees will frequently use material handling equipment, such as forklifts and cranes.
Work Environment
This job operates in a factory environment. While performing the duties of this job, the employee is frequently exposed to fumes or airborne particles, moving mechanical parts and vibration. The employee is occasionally exposed to outside weather conditions. The noise level in the work environment is often loud enough to require hearing protection.
